Contested by 16 clubs, it operates on a system of promotion and relegation with Allsvenskan and Division 1.
During the course of a season (starting in April and ending in October) each club plays the other twice, once at their home stadium and once at that of their opponents, for a total of 30 games.
The Swiss corporation Kentaro has owned the TV rights for Superettan since 2006.
[7] The highest attendance ever recorded at a Superettan match is 31,074 (Hammarby vs Ljungskile in 2014).
[8] The league's best season attendance-wise was 2014 when Hammarby's average attendance reached a level that was extraordinary for Superettan.
